The face of America’s out-of-control gun was arrested after pointing a shotgun at his girlfriend, smashing a glass-topped table and pushing her out of her Florida home.  It’s the latest in a string of troubles involving George Zimmerman since her was acquitted of murdering black teenager Trayvon Martin earlier this year.

It started in the Monday lunch hour when his 27-year-old girlfriend Samantha Scheibe asked Zimmerman to leave.  He “began packing his items, which included a shotgun and a AR assault rifle,” according to the police report.  When the argument escalated, Scheibe called police and told deputies that Zimmerman then pointed the shotgun at her.  He allegedly broke a glass table, pushed her out of her own home, and barricaded the door with furniture. 

“She was concerned for her safety, certainly from having the weapon pointed at her,” said Chief Deputy Dennis Lemma of the Seminole County Sheriff's Office.  Authorities released that police call to the US media.

In recent months, Zimmerman has had a few run-ins with the law.  The most serious of which was 9 September, his estranged wife, Shellie, and her father accused him of threatening them with a gun while they were moving out her belongings.

In July, a Florida jury found him not guilty of murdering 17-year old African-American teen Trayvon Martin while Zimmerman was stalking his neighborhood as a self-appointed neighborhood watchman.  Zimmerman admitted shooting and killing the unarmed teen, who was merely walking back home after going out to buy some iced tea and candy.
